What are the factors affecting energy of motion

Respuesta :

LaNyaMurphy
LaNyaMurphy LaNyaMurphy
  • 03-10-2019

Answer:

The factors that affect your energy of motion are speed and weight. The energy of motion increases proportionally with the increase in weight, and the energy increases proportionally with the square of the increase in speed. Traction enables your tires to grip to the road and control your vehicle.
